firmware: Support position independent execution
Enable OpenSBI to support position independent execution. Because the position independent code will cause an additional GOT reference when accessing the global variables, it will reduce performance a bit. Therefore, the position independent execution is disabled by default. Users can through specifying "FW_PIC=y" on the make command to enable this feature. In theory, after enabling position-independent execution, the OpenSBI can run at arbitrary address with appropriate alignment. Therefore, the original relocation mechanism will be skipped.
